#731f0f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#731f0f is composed of 45.1% red, 12.2% green and 5.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 73% magenta, 87% yellow and 54.9% black. It has a hue angle of 9.6 degrees, a saturation of 76.9% and a lightness of 25.5%. #731f0f color hex could be obtained by blending #e63e1e with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#663300.

Shades and Tints of #731f0f

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0b0301 is the darkest color, while #fef9f9 is the lightest one.

Tones of #731f0f

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#414141 is the less saturated color, while #7d1805 is the most saturated one.
